Teddi Mellencamp, a well-known figure from the "Real Housewives" franchise, recently revealed that she has been diagnosed with multiple brain tumors. The 43-year-old podcast host and television personality shared the news on her social media, stating that she had been experiencing severe and debilitating headaches in recent weeks. These headaches became so intense that she required hospitalization.
Following a CT scan and an MRI, doctors discovered multiple tumors on Mellencamp's brain. These tumors are believed to have been growing for at least six months. Two of the tumors will be surgically removed, while smaller ones will be treated with radiation at a later date.
Mellencamp is no stranger to sharing her personal life with the public. She has previously spoken openly about her divorce from Edwin Arroyave, as well as her medical history, which includes melanoma and IVF treatment. She and Arroyave have three children together, and Mellencamp also has a stepdaughter, Isabella Arroyave.
Mellencamp's announcement has been met with an outpouring of support from fans and fellow celebrities. Many have expressed their well wishes and offered prayers for her recovery.
